The portions are enormous and the food is quite delicious. They really commit to the theme with waitresses in corsets and leather, leather bound menus, Norse inscriptions on the wall, and drinks out of rams horns - so depends how into themes you are. As part of the meal you have to choose a "weapon" (knife) from a leather holster, the look like LOTR weapons.

Description

Mjølner is created in Thor’s image and deliver’s a unique dining experience, offering our guests escapism with the enjoyment of fine food and world class beverages. Mjølner (pronounced Mjol-near) draws inspiration from the grand Asgardian feasts of Valhalla, where the Viking Gods indulged their senses both day and night. The restaurant combines historic Viking features with contemporary Scandinavian design.
